Course Overview

International Relations at Chester is an internationally research-informed course that offers students multiple world perspectives on the key global issues affecting the world today. A unique blend of theoretical and practical skills is gained through the course to enable graduates to contribute to an understanding of the changing nature of the world around us. The program team comprises active researchers and specialists who are committed to providing a transformative and world-informed education that contributes to greater global citizenship.

We are proud of our National Student Survey results for intellectual rigor and offer students the opportunity to realize their full intellectual potential in a safe environment that is conducive to learning and debate.

Our passionate International Relations Team shares a number of research awards and local and international teaching awards. Last year, the university research-informed teaching award was awarded to a staff member in this program.

General Eligibility

GCE A Level:

112 UCAS points from GCE A Levels or equivalent. Typical offer - BCC/BBC

BTEC:

BTEC Extended Diploma: DMM

T Level:

T Level with a Merit grade

Irish/Scottish Highers:

Irish Highers - H3, H3, H3, H3, H4

Scottish Highers - BBBB

International Baccalaureate :

26 points

Access requirements:

Access to HE Diploma to include 45 credits at level 3, 30 of which must be at Merit.

OCR:

OCR National Extended Diploma: Merit 2

OCR Cambridge Technical Extended Diploma - DMM

OCR Cambridge Technical Diploma - D*D*

Extra Information / General Entry Requirements:

Please note that we accept a maximum of 8 points from GCE AS Levels and that the Welsh Baccalaureate (core) and A-level General Studies will be recognized in our offer. We will also consider a combination of A levels and BTECs/OCRs.
